a. A unique feature wall and ceiling system that creates striking interior effects through the use of Wovin tiles clipped into a grid system in alternating directions to create a distinctive, three dimensional woven pattern on walls and ceilings. Available in a wide variety of standard finishes such as timber veneer, polypropylene, laminate, aluminium and printed images. They can also be made from custom materials. Adjusted lighting and backlit tiles can be used to create striking effects. Through laser cutting or routing, custom patterns can be crafted to meet individual requirements as well as custom printing which allows it to be the perfect medium for photographs or company graphics.

b. Wave Wall is an organic, undulating wave of elegantly, long tile finishes available in either continuous or alternating patterns. Wave Wall like is a modular system making it easy to transport, install and is available in most of the same finishes as Wovin Wall.
